Jakarta, Feb 21 (ANTARA) - Visiting Thai Prime Minister Abhisit Vejjajiva said ASEAN was forging stronger and more dynamic partnerships with the rest of the world in order to maintain regional peace, prosperity, and social wellbeing.
"ASEAN will continue to be an outward-looking organization by forging regional integration and cooperation with the rest of the world," Abhisit said in his keynote address before foreign diplomats at the ASEAN Secretariat here on Saturday.
He said ASEAN had also evolved into an internationally recognized and respected regional grouping.
"We have been able to attract our friends and Dialog Partners from all corners of the world to participate in our regional development and support our community-building efforts," he said.
The Thai prime minister noted that by providing a platform for engagement, dialogs and cooperation, ASEAN had been instrumental in forging closer partnerships with all key players who had an impact in the region and at the global level.
He said that in the new era, ASEAN's work had only begun and it still facing many international and regional challenges.
"In an ever more globalized and interconnected world, no country nor region can be isolated from the international surroundings," Abhisit said, adding that ASEAN could not afford to be complacent and could not afford to be inward-looking.
He said there were newly emerging challenges and threats which tend to be trans-national and trans-boundary in nature.
"The recent global financial crisis has, yet again, underscored the fact that no country in this region is immune to the expanding of global uncertainties, and therefore we must step up our cooperation," Abhisit said.
He added that later this year Thailand would convene the ASEAN Plus Three and Eas Asia Summits which would be another good opportunity for regional leaders to have open and extensive discussion on issues of common interest.
Abhisit concluded his address by emphasizing that ASEAN would continue moving forward and the best way forward was to continue more rapidly in its journey, with focus and determination, towards the goal of building an ASEAN Community.
"Only through a more integrated ASEAN can we be competitive globally. Only through a more integrated ASEAN can we withstand challenges, and only through a more integrated ASEAN can we ensure a better future for all our people," he said.
